 Herbal Treatments For Hormonal Imbalances





Hormonal imbalances can occur due to a variety of reasons such as stress, poor diet, lack of exercise, and certain medical conditions. In some cases, herbal treatments can help to restore balance to the endocrine system and alleviate symptoms associated with hormonal imbalances.


Here are some herbal treatments for hormonal imbalances:


Black Cohosh: 





This herb is commonly used to alleviate symptoms associated with menopause such as hot flashes, night sweats, and mood swings. Black cohosh is believed to work by acting as a natural estrogen replacement.


Chaste Tree Berry:






 Also known as Vitex, this herb is commonly used to regulate menstrual cycles and alleviate symptoms associated with premenstrual syndrome (PMS). Chaste tree berry works by supporting the production of luteinizing hormone (LH) and reducing the production of follicle-stimulating hormone (FSH).


Dong Quai: 








This herb is commonly used in traditional Chinese medicine to alleviate symptoms associated with menstrual cramps, irregular periods, and menopause. Dong Quai is believed to work by increasing blood flow to the reproductive organs and promoting hormonal balance.


Maca: 





This root vegetable is commonly used to alleviate symptoms associated with menopause, PMS, and infertility. Maca is believed to work by balancing hormones and promoting the production of estrogen, progesterone, and testosterone.


Red Clover: 





This herb is commonly used to alleviate symptoms associated with menopause such as hot flashes and night sweats. Red clover is believed to work by acting as a natural estrogen replacement.


Rhodiola: 






This adaptogenic herb is commonly used to alleviate symptoms associated with stress such as anxiety, fatigue, and depression. Rhodiola is believed to work by regulating cortisol levels and reducing inflammation in the body.


Shatavari: 





This herb is commonly used in Ayurvedic medicine to alleviate symptoms associated with menstrual irregularities, infertility, and menopause. Shatavari is believed to work by promoting hormonal balance and nourishing the reproductive organs.


Tribulus: 





This herb is commonly used to alleviate symptoms associated with low libido and erectile dysfunction. Tribulus is believed to work by increasing testosterone levels and improving blood flow to the reproductive organs.


Wild Yam:





 This herb is commonly used to alleviate symptoms associated with menopause such as hot flashes and vaginal dryness. Wild yam is believed to work by acting as a natural estrogen replacement.


It is important to note that herbal treatments should not be used as a substitute for medical treatment. It is always important to consult with a healthcare professional before using any herbal treatments, especially if you are pregnant or nursing. Additionally, some herbs can interact with certain medications, so it is important to speak with your doctor or pharmacist before starting any herbal treatments.
